Back to Generation
Solution
1. Preparation
  • Gather the necessary tools and replacement fuses.
  • Ensure the vehicle is parked on a flat surface and turned off.
  • Disconnect the battery for safety, especially if working with high-current fuses.
2. Locate the Fuse Box
  • Tools Required: None specific; just ensure you have the owner's manual.
  • The fuse boxes in the VW Passat B8 are typically located in two places:
    • Under the dashboard on the driver's side.
    • In the engine compartment.
3. Inspect and Remove the Fuse
  • Tools Required: Fuse puller (often located in the fuse box), tweezers, or pliers.
  • Using the owner's manual, locate the specific fuse for the malfunctioning component.
  • With the fuse puller or tweezers, carefully remove the fuse from its socket.
  • Inspect the fuse: look for a broken filament or discoloration indicating it is blown.
4. Replace the Fuse
  • Parts Required: Replacement fuses (ensure the amperage matches the original).
  • Insert the new fuse into the same slot, ensuring it is seated properly.
  • If multiple fuses are blown, check for underlying electrical issues before replacing.
5. Reconnect Battery and Test
  • Reconnect the battery if it was disconnected.
  • Turn on the vehicle and test the electrical component to verify functionality.
